WebApr 10, 2024 · Diabetes mellitus (DM) and osteoarthritis (OA) are chronic noncommunicable diseases that affect millions of people worldwide. OA and DM are prevalent worldwide and associated with chronic pain and disability. Evidence suggests that DM and OA coexist within the same population. WebMar 14, 2024 · Lumbar disc degeneration is characterized by back pain caused by the breakdown of one or more the spinal discs in the lower back. After more than 10 years of living with diabetes, individuals are at greater risk of developing painful disc degeneration in the lumbar spine (lower back).
